Overview The Project Manager Associate PMO is responsible for providing project management support to the Project Management Office (PMO). This role is responsible for coordinating and managing projects, ensuring that project objectives are met, and that project deliverables are completed on time and within budget. Detailed Job Description The Project Manager Associate PMO is responsible for providing project management support to the PMO. This role is responsible for coordinating and managing projects, ensuring that project objectives are met, and that project deliverables are completed on time and within budget. The Project Manager Associate PMO will work closely with the PMO team to ensure that projects are planned, executed, monitored, and closed in a timely and efficient manner. Job Skills Required
